Tender Overview

Oil India Limited seeks supply of RCBOs with integral overcurrent protection, ISI marked to IS 12640 (Part 2). The scope covers delivery of RCBOs through OEM or authorized dealers, with warranty as per supplier terms and post-installation support. The bid requires detailed technical catalogues and OEM authorizations, and imposes GST considerations borne by bidders. The arrangement allows quantity adjustments up to 25% during and after contract, with delivery timelines tied to original periods and extended periods. Location and start/end dates are not disclosed in the tender data.
